Crucial phase
  • Increase in alcohol tolerance.
  • Surreptitious drinking.
  • Urgency of first drink.
  • Unable to discuss problem.
  • Drinking bolstered with excuses.
  • Persistent remorse.
  • Promises and resolutions fail.
  • Loss of other interests.
  • Work and money troubles.
  • Neglect of food.
  • Tremors and early morning drinks.
  • Occasional relief drinking.
  • Constant relief drinking commences.
  • Onset of memory blackouts increasing dependence on alcohol.
  • Feelings of guilt.
  • Memory blackouts increase.
  • Decrease of ability to stop drinking when others do so grandiose and aggressive behavior.
  • Efforts to control fail repeatedly.
  • Tries geographical escapes.
  • Family and friends avoided.
  • Unreasonable resentments.
  • Loss of ordinary willpower.
  • Decrease in alcohol tolerance.
Chronic phase
  • Physical deterioration.
  • Moral deterioration.
  • Drinking with inferiors.
  • Unable to initiate action vague spiritual desire.
  • Complete defeat.
  • Obsessive drinking continues in vicious circles.
Rehabilitation
  • Learns alcoholism is an illness.
  • Stops taking alcohol.
  • Assisted in making personal stocktaking.
  • Spiritual needs examined.
  • Onset of New hope.
  • Appreciation of possibilities of new way of life.
  • Regular nourishment taken.
  • Realistic thinking.
  • Natural rest and sleep family and friends appreciate efforts.
  • Facts faced with courage.
  • Increase of emotional control.
  • First step towards economic stability.
  • Rationalizations recognized.
  • Onset of lengthy intoxications.
  • Impaired thinking.
  • Indefinable fears.
  • Obsession with drinking.
  • All alibis exhausted.
  • Honest desire for help told addiction can be arrested.
  • Meets former addicts normal and happy.
  • Right thinking begins.
  • Physical overhaul by doctor.
  • Star of group therapy.
  • Diminishing fears of the unknown future.
  • Return of self esteem.
  • Desire to escape goes.
  • Adjustment to family needs.
  • New interests develop.
  • Rebirth of ideals.
  • Application of real values.
  • Confidence of employers.
Contentment in sobriety
  • Group therapy and mutual help continue.
  • Increasing tolerance.
  • Enlightened and interesting way of life.
  • Opens up with road ahead to higher levels than ever before.
